which group has individual investors as participants and is a lender of funds to the financial markets? multiple choice question

. people with no ideas and no money lend funds to the financial markets. people with money and no ideas lend funds to the financial markets. people with ideas and no money lend funds to the financial markets. people with both money and ideas lend funds to the financial markets.

The financial markets are financed by those with money but no ideas, and they also include private investors as participants.

A marketplace where bonds, equities, securities, and currencies are traded is referred to as a financial market. Few financial markets do daily security transactions worth trillions of dollars, whereas some are smaller and less active. These are marketplaces where investors gain more money, firms increase their cash flow, and dangers are reduced.

The selling and purchasing of financial assets and securities takes place in a venue known as a financial market. In the economy of the country, it distributes scarce resources. By facilitating the transfer of funds between investors and collectors, it acts as an intermediary.

On a financial market, the stock market enables investors to buy and sell shares of publicly traded corporations. The primary stock market is where new stocks are initially offered, together with other stock securities.
